1. Types of gear systems
The gear systems of electric bicycles are mainly divided into three types: single-speed, internal gear, and external gear, each with different advantages and disadvantages.
(1) Single-Speed
- Features:
Only one gear ratio, no need to shift gears, simple and durable.
Suitable for short-distance commuting, flat roads, low maintenance cost.
- Applicable motor:
Hub motor (front/rear wheel drive)
Suitable for low-power motors (250W-500W)
- Applicable scenarios:
Urban commuting, leisure riding, shared bicycles.
(2) Internal Gear Hub
- Features:
The gearshift system is enclosed in the hub of the e-bike, which is very durable and requires almost no maintenance.
The speed change range is generally small, usually 3 speeds, 5 speeds, 7 speeds, and 8 speeds.
The speed change can be achieved when the bicycle is stationary, ensuring safety during riding.
- Applicable motors:
Both hub motors and mid-mounted motors can be used.
- Applicable scenarios:
Urban riding, long-distance riding (8 speeds or above are recommended).
(3) External Derailleur System
- Features:
Uses external chain and flywheel for speed change, light weight, and wide gear ratio range.
Maintenance is relatively complex, and the chain is easy to wear.
Suitable for various complex terrains, such as mountain biking, long-distance biking, etc.
- Applicable motor:
Mid-mounted motor is best (gears can be used to expand the torque range).
Hub motors can also be used, but the overall efficiency is lower.
- Applicable scenarios:
Long-distance biking, mountain cross-country, road biking.
2. Choose the most suitable gear system according to the terrain
1. City riding/flat roads
City riding is mostly on flat roads, and needs to deal with the impact of starting, acceleration and short slopes, and has less shaking, simple daily maintenance and is not prone to failure.
- Recommended gear system: 7-speed(1×7) or internal gear
- Recommended model: City E-Bike
- Recommended motor: Hub Motor, 250W-500W

2. Countryside riding
There are some gravels and sand on the country roads, which also have certain requirements for brakes and tire anti-skid. At the same time, a wider gear range is required. The system with a front derailleur can support low-gear climbing and maintain a good speed on flat ground. Of course! If you don’t like the front derailleur, 1×9 is also a good choice.
- Recommended gear system: 21 speed (3×7) or 9 speed (1×9)
- Recommended model: Hybrid E-Bike
- Recommended motor: Mid-Drive Motor, 500W-750W

3. Mountain off-road
Steep terrain requires strong low-gear support, while high gear is suitable for downhill sprints, and a wider gear ratio range is also required on rugged mountain roads
- Recommended gear system: 12-speed (1×12) or 3×10
- Recommended model: electric mountain bike
- Recommended motor: mid-drive motor, 750W-1000W, high torque (85Nm+)

4. Long-distance riding
Long-distance riding requires stability and low maintenance costs, and requires the use of internal gearing or a wide range of gear ratios to adapt to all-terrain conditions.
- Recommended gear system: 14-speed Rohloff internal gearing or 2×11 speed
- Recommended model: E-Touring Bike
- Recommended motor: 1000W or even higher power motor, 600Wh+ large capacity battery
